[75] In certain terms, President Clinton’s Order states: “This order shall not be construed to create any right to judicial review involving the compliance or noncompliance of the United States, its agencies, its officers, or any other person with this order.”[76], The Presidential Memorandum that accompanied the Order iterated this point, reaffirming the intent of President Clinton to focus on “improv[ing] the internal management of the Executive Branch.”[77] More generally, executive orders are rarely reviewable, and federal courts have said that executive orders are not enforceable in private civil suits unless the Order “was ‘intended’ by the President to be ‘a legal framework enforceable by private civil action,’ as opposed to a ‘managerial tool for implementing the President’s personal . [87] For example, the District Court for the Northern District of Texas in City of Dallas v. Hall stated that when an agency considers environmental justice as a portion of its NEPA analysis and the consideration appears in the administrative record, the consideration then becomes reviewable under the APA.[88]. An example of the environmental injustices that indigenous groups face can be seen in the Chevron-Texaco incident in the Amazon rainforest. Texaco, which is now Chevron, found oil in Ecuador in 1964 and built sub-standard oil wells to cut costs. Provost & Gerber, supra note 35 (“To comply with Clinton’s EO 12898, federal agencies typically state that a new rule will either have a positive effect on environmental inequities or no effect—both of which suggest that the agency actively investigated the issue.”).
